Since then, Aufbau-Verlag has worked with many notable German authors and international writers. In fact, the company actively sought Jewish writers and other authors who had been forced to hide during the Nazi regime. Aufbau-Verlagīased in Berlin, Aufbau-Verlag was founded in 1945 with the mission to provide Germany with much-needed literary nourishment after the fall of Hitler.
